General description

β-N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ide (NAD) is a ubiquitously found electron carrier and a cofactor. NAD+ contains an adenylic acid and a nicotinamide-5′-ribonucleotide group linked together by a pyrophosphate moiety. In NAD+ complexes, the enzyme-cofactor interactions are highly conserved.

Biochem/physiol Actions

β-N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ide (NAD) significantly participates in enzyme-catalyzed oxido-reduction processes and many genetic processes. It cycles between the oxidized (NAD+) and reduced (NADH) forms to maintain a redox balance necessary for continued cell growth. NAD is also involved in microbial catabolism.
